Onko Solidity OOP-kieli?

0


Solidity on olio-ohjelmointikieli älykkäiden sopimusten toteuttamiseen useilla lohkoketjualustoilla, erityisesti Ethereumilla.

Onko Solidity OOP?

Ethereum-alustan päätoimittajat ovat kehittäneet Solidityn, oliosuuntautuneen ohjelmointikielen. Sitä käytetään älykkäiden sopimusten suunnitteluun ja toteuttamiseen Ethereum Virtual Platformissa ja useissa muissa Blockchain-alustoissa.

Mikä kieli Solidity on?

Solidity on staattisesti kirjoitettu aaltosulkeinen ohjelmointikieli, joka on suunniteltu Ethereumissa toimivien älykkäiden sopimusten kehittämiseen.

Onko Solidity sama kuin C++?

Koska Solidity-syntaksi on kuin C++-syntaksi, siinä on monia samoja lausekkeita ja ohjausrakenteita, joita tavallisesti käytetään aaltosulkeisissa kielissä, kuten if, else, while, do for, break, jatka ja return. Se tukee myös poikkeusten käsittelyä try/catch-lauseiden avulla.

Pitäisikö minun opetella Solidity tai Python?

Tästä syystä suosittelen ohjelmoinnin aloittelijalle Javascriptin tai Pythonin oppimista ennen Solidityn oppimista. Vaikka tämä saattaa kestää kauemmin, se auttaa sinua pitkällä aikavälillä rakentamalla vahvemman perustan kehittäjänä.

Onko Solidity sama kuin C++?

Koska Solidity-syntaksi on kuin C++-syntaksi, siinä on monia samoja lausekkeita ja ohjausrakenteita, joita tavallisesti käytetään aaltosulkeisissa kielissä, kuten if, else, while, do for, break, jatka ja return. Se tukee myös poikkeusten käsittelyä try/catch-lauseiden avulla.

Onko Solidityn oppiminen vaikeaa?

Solidity on täydellinen seuraava askel kehittäjille, joilla on kokemusta joko Pythonista tai Javascriptistä, mutta se on myös suhteellisen helppo oppia (kun seuraat tiettyä koulutusohjelmaa), jotta jopa aloittelijat voivat ottaa sen käyttöön ilman aikaisempaa kokemusta.

Kuinka paljon Solidity-kehittäjä maksaatehdä?

Solidity Developerin arvioitu kokonaispalkka on 76 674 dollaria vuodessa Yhdysvaltojen alueella ja keskipalkka 66 326 dollaria vuodessa. Nämä luvut edustavat mediaania, joka on oman kokonaispalkkaarviomme ja käyttäjiltämme kerättyjen palkkojen vaihteluvälien keskipiste.

Onko Solidity samanlainen kuin Java?

Solidity on staattisesti kirjoitettu ohjelmointikieli, aivan kuten Java, C++ tai C. Se tarkoittaa, että kehittäjien muuttujatyypit tunnetaan käännöshetkellä.

Kuinka kauan Solidityn oppiminen kestää?

Tämä tarkoittaa, että ihmisillä, joilla on kokemusta yleisistä ohjelmointikonsepteista ja edellä mainituista koodauskielistä, kuluisi lyhyempi aika Solidityn oppimiseen. Tämä voi kestää yhdestä kuuteen kuukauteen.

Onko Python Solidity?

Solidity on kiharahaarukkakieli, joka on suunniteltu kohdistamaan Ethereum Virtual Machine (EVM). Siihen vaikuttavat C++, Python ja JavaScript. Kielivaikutteet-osiossa on lisätietoja Solidityn inspiraation saaneista kielistä.

Onko Solidity vain Ethereumille?

Solidity on tällä hetkellä Ethereumin ja muiden kilpailevilla alustoilla toimivien yksityisten lohkoketjujen ydinkieli, kuten Monax ja sen Hyperledger Burrow -lohkoketju, joka käyttää Tendermintia konsensukseen. SWIFT on luonut proof of conceptin, joka toimii Burrowissa ja käyttää Solidityä.

Voiko ei-ohjelmoija oppia Solidityä?

Kyllä, ehdottomasti. Jos haluat oppia kirjoittamaan dappeja (hajautettuja sovelluksia, sovelluksia, jotka toimivat lohkoketjujen päällä), Solidity on melko hyvä valinta. Varmista vain, että tiedät jo JavaScriptin (olennaisesti Solidity toimii ”taustakielinä”, mutta tarvitset silti JS:n käyttöliittymään ja työkaluihin, kuten Truffle).

Voitko oppia Solidityn ilman koodausta?

Kaksiopetussuunnitelmat sisältävät älykkään sopimussuunnittelun perus- ja keskitason välillä ja edistyneitä Solidity-konsepteja. Jos olet aloittelija ilman koodauskokemusta, ilmaisten peruskurssien suorittaminen saattaa auttaa. Aloita perusasioista, kuten Web3:n opiskelusta.

Onko Blockchain oliosuuntautunut?

C# ja sen lohkoketjualustat Se on oliokieli, jota voidaan käyttää lohkoketjun kehittämiseen. Jotkut C#:lla toteutetut lohkoketjuprojektit ovat: Neo. IOTA Stratis.

Onko Blockchain olioohjelmointia?

Päinvastoin lohkoketju perustuu olio-ohjelmoinnin loistavaan konseptiin. Olio-ohjelmoinnin päälähtökohta on, että sekä data että suorituskoodi tallennetaan samaan paikkaan, jota kutsutaan objektiksi.

Ovatko älykkäät sopimukset objekteja?

Perinteisten sopimusten tapaan älykkäät sopimukset määrittelevät säännöt ja rangaistukset sopimuksen ympärille ja panevat ne automaattisesti täytäntöön. Vaikka ne voivat työskennellä itsenäisesti, monia älykkäitä sopimuksia voidaan toteuttaa myös yhdessä. Älykkään sopimuksen olennaisia ​​komponentteja kutsutaan objekteiksi.

Onko Solidityssä kursseja?

Solidityssä on kaksi tapaa tarjota luokka tehokkaasti, ja toinen niistä on peritty perussopimus. Peritty perussopimus on kirjoitettu normaaliksi sopimukseksi, joka sisältää tietoja ja toimintoja, jotka voivat vaikuttaa näihin tietoihin, mutta ovat tyypillisesti epätäydellisiä tai vain osa koko sopimuksesta.

Onko Solidity sama kuin C++?

Koska Solidity-syntaksi on kuin C++-syntaksi, siinä on monia samoja lausekkeita ja ohjausrakenteita, joita tavallisesti käytetään aaltosulkeisissa kielissä, kuten if, else, while, do for, break, jatka ja return. Se tukee myös poikkeusten käsittelyä try/catch-lauseiden avulla.

Pitäisikö minun oppia Solidity taiPython?

Tästä syystä suosittelen ohjelmoinnin aloittelijalle Javascriptin tai Pythonin oppimista ennen Solidityn oppimista. Vaikka tämä saattaa kestää kauemmin, se auttaa sinua pitkällä aikavälillä rakentamalla vahvemman perustan kehittäjänä.

Onko Solidity-kehittäjille kysyntää?

Pitäisikö minun opetella Java ennen Solidityä?

Solidityssä. OOP-kielen, kuten Javan, kanssa työskentely helpottaa sellaisten käsitteiden ymmärtämistä kuin sopimusperintö, sopimusmenetelmien ohittaminen jne.

Leave A Reply

Your email address will not be published.